The 1982 Garuda Fokker F28 crash (flight number unknown) occurred on March 20, 1982, when a Fokker F28, operated by Garuda Indonesia, overran the runway at Tanjung Karang-Branti Airport in the province of Lampung in Indonesia during very heavy rain.[1] The aircraft came to rest just 700 meters from the runway in a field, with the aircraft catching fire.[1] All passengers and crew died.
